Last Sunday, I taught on 2 Kings 17. The main lesson which I found was God is not a God that we can mock. He does not tolerate our hypocrisy forever. We cannot pretend to be His disciples. We cannot say we follow the Lord but our actions and deeds are contrary to His Word and Will.
God expects us to repent of our sins and obey Him promptly. If we don't, we will face His judgment and suffer His punishment like the disobedient hypocritical Israelites did in the book of 2 Kings 17.

May we be first and foremost Christlike, manifesting the fruit of the Holy Spirit (Galatians 5:22-23). Let us always obey God and His Word. OBEDIENCE to Our Lord God is the BOTTOM-LINE of our religion. Everything else is secondary. We may sing, shout, praise, dance, pray, read, meditate, write, preach, etc, etc...,but what counts is the actual execution of God's commands, living it out in our daily lives, wherever we are.
Actually, the first and foremost commandment of God is to love Him with all our hearts, souls, minds, and strength. The second is to love our neighbors as ourselves. The kind of love being referred to here is agape, the God kind of sacrificial love, the kind of love that Jesus Christ demonstrated unto us, even unto His most cruel unjust death on the cross.
God said in His Word, that if we love Him, we will obey His commandments (John 14:15). So, the bottom-line of the true Christian religion is to OBEY God and His Word, to practice it, to live it out. All the rest is futile without this true genuine obedience to Our Lord God.
